The EU notes with concern that the Israeli Government has authorized the construction of 307 dwellings in the Har Homa settlement in east Jerusalem. The EU considers that this initiative might undermine ongoing efforts in the search for peace and confidence building between the Parties, especially at this point in time. The EU urges Israel to honour the commitments under the Road Map and to avoid activities that could prejudge a final status agreement on Jerusalem or undermine progress towards this goal. * Croatia and the former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ia continue to be part of the Stabilisation and Association Process. |
